JsonObject - 脚本和图表函数
JsonObject 用于构建 JSON 对象。
信息注释您可以使用 JsonObject 添加任意数量的名称-值对。
                语法:
JsonObject(name, value [name, value, ...])
返回数据类型: 双
参数:
| 参数 | 说明 | 
|---|---|
| json | 包含 JSON 数据的字符串。 | 
| 名称 | JSON 格式的字段名称。 | 
| 值 | JSON 格式的字符串值。 | 
示例:
以下加载脚本将数据加载并设置为 JSON 对象。
Data:
Load *,
	JsonObject('id', Id,
		'name', Name,
		'address', Address,
		'phone', Phone,
		'fax', FaxOrNull) AS Json;
LOAD *, If(Fax='-',Null(),Fax) AS FaxOrNull;
LOAD * INLINE [
	Id, Name,       Address,     Phone,     Fax
	1,  John Doe,   Oak Way,   1 234 567, 1 234 568
	2,  Jane Doe, Maple Way, 123456,    -
	3,  Mr Xavier,       Spruce Way,   1-800-MRX
];
                由此得到了以下 JSON 数据:
{"id":1,"name":"John Doe","address":"Oak Way","phone":"1 234 567","fax":"1 234 568"}
{"id":2,"name":"Jane Doe","address":"Maple Way","phone":123456}
{"id":3,"name":"Mr Xavier","address":"Spruce Way","phone":"1-800-MRX","fax":""}